11Alive Storm Trackers are watching the weather as temperatures are expected dip Friday night.

During the overnight hours into Saturday morning, some parts of Northern Georgia could experience some winter weather. Here's a timeline of the possible conditions leading up to Christmas.

SATURDAY

By Saturday morning, some of the highest elevations in far North Georgia could see some winter weather. A winter weather advisory has been issued for some counties. 

Fannin, Union, Rabun, and other counties in the north could see temperatures drop below freezing. There could be ice on the ground and there's also a chance for snow.

Closer to Atlanta, temperatures will most likely be above freezing. By afternoon, things should warm up a bit, to the upper 40s

SUNDAY

There's still a slight possibility for rain on Sunday. The forecast right now shows a 20 percent chance. Showers could continue throughout the day and overnight.

CHRISTMAS EVE

Temperatures should reach the mid-50s Monday with sunshine.

CHRISTMAS 

The day will start off cold with temperatures in the 30s but things will warm up as temperatures  reach the 50s. There is also a chance for rain.
